Imprint, Cardinal Logan 24, Logan Chief, Peter Pdngcn ■l6, Jewel Pointer 60. BOXING CHAMPIONSHIP KEENEY A XT) TUXXEY IX TRAINING. NEW YOU re, June M. A message from Eairhaven says that Tom lleeney has commenced active training. He weighed 20Glh. After three miles and a-haif road work he boxed eight rounds, but looked slow and heavy, his sparring partners hitting him at will. _ Heeney complained that the eanvns impeded his speed in moving about. Tunney did eight miles of road work, and put. on the gloves for the first time smeo his last bont with Dempsey. Ho had a workout, after which the out over hi.s left eye was showing up.—Australian Press Association. CRICKET COACH RE-ENGAGEO {.Pea Uxirtu Press Association - .] AUCKLAND. .Imu>, Id. J. Wright’s Hillcourt Lass, with Messrs Darragh and Maher’s I’ndy runner-up. A DELAYED TELEGRAM ACCEPTANCE MISSED. (Per Oritep Press Association.] AUCKLAND, June Id. A telegram sent by 0. K. Hooper from Harrhill, Canterbury, accepting with King Pointer for all engagements at the Auckland Trotting Meeting, although handed in at Barrhill at 1 o’clock this afternoon, was not received at Auckland until 8.17 to-night. Tho acceptances closed at id o’clock. Tiie chief postmaster at Auckland advises that the delay was caused through the telegram being mislaid at Harrhill.
